What are Kurds in Iraq?

The Kurds are a distinct ethnic group from the Arabs that predominate in southern and central Iraq. They have a unique language, distinct holidays, a multiplicity of religions (some unique to the Kurds), and political autonomy in Iraq.

Kurds are the second largest ethnic group in what country?

Kurds are the second largest ethnic group in TURKEY(after Turks) and in IRAQ and SYRIA (after Arabs). In Iran, Kurds are the third largest ethnic group behind Persians and Azeris.
